No dust-wrapper. Owner name neatly inside. The Assimil language learning approach initiated by Alphonse Cherél first appeared in 1929 with 'Anglais Sans Peine'. The methodology was an early example based on using records alongside the textbook. Assimil's recognisable stylised logo depicts a long-playing record.

The fourth edition of British Navy surgeon and naturalist Richard William Coppinger's account of his Pacific cruise onboard the HMS Alert from 1878 to 1882. Whilst on HMS Alert, Coppinger collected botanical specimens from Magellan Straits landfalls, Tahiti, Fiji, Australia, the Torres Strait Islands, Singapore, and the Seychelles, in addition to gathering extensive zoological collections.Illustrated with sixteen plates, and a small number of vignette illustrations. Collated, complete.With the blind stamp of Joesph A. Sadony to the head of the title page. Sadony was a philosopher and spiritualist, known for briefly working for Theodore Roosevelt, and his eighty acre estate, named 'The Valley of the Pines', in rural Michigan.
